Αλλάξτε τις ρυθμίσεις σε Break on Unhandled errors για αντιμετώπιση προβλημάτων
- Το σφάλμα χρόνου εκτέλεσης 5 είναι σφάλμα VBA και εμφανίζεται συνήθως στο Excel.
- Η εσφαλμένη απενεργοποίηση του προγράμματος χειρισμού σφαλμάτων είναι μία από τις κύριες αιτίες αυτού του σφάλματος.
- Δοκιμάστε να αλλάξετε τις ρυθμίσεις σε Break on Unhandled errors στο VBA για να λύσετε αυτό το πρόβλημα.
ΧΕΓΚΑΤΑΣΤΑΣΗ ΚΑΝΟΝΤΑΣ ΚΛΙΚ ΣΤΟ ΑΡΧΕΙΟ ΛΗΨΗΣ
- Κατεβάστε το Fortect και εγκαταστήστε το στον υπολογιστή σας.
- Ξεκινήστε τη διαδικασία σάρωσης του εργαλείου για να αναζητήσετε κατεστραμμένα αρχεία που είναι η πηγή του προβλήματός σας.
- Κάντε δεξί κλικ Ξεκινήστε την επισκευή ώστε το εργαλείο να μπορεί να ξεκινήσει τον αλγόριθμο επιδιόρθωσης.
- Το Fortect έχει ληφθεί από 0 αναγνώστες αυτόν τον μήνα.
Το σφάλμα χρόνου εκτέλεσης 5: Μη έγκυρη κλήση διαδικασίας ή σφάλμα ορίσματος εμφανίζεται όταν αλλάζετε τη θέση του καταλόγου sysdata σε έναν κοινόχρηστο κατάλογο στο δίκτυο. Συμβαίνει όταν η αλλαγή προέρχεται από το πλαίσιο διαλόγου Change SYSDATA Directory του Microsoft FRx. Ωστόσο, αυτός ο οδηγός θα συζητήσει πώς να το διορθώσετε.
Εναλλακτικά, μπορεί να σας ενδιαφέρει ο οδηγός μας για την επίλυση του Σφάλμα χρόνου εκτέλεσης: δεν ήταν δυνατή η κλήση του proc σε υπολογιστές με Windows.
Τι προκαλεί το σφάλμα χρόνου εκτέλεσης 5;
- Τα ανεπαρκή δικαιώματα με το Microsoft FRx μπορεί να προκαλέσουν προβλήματα με τις εντολές πρόσβασης ή εγγραφής
- Μια μη έγκυρη διαδρομή δικτύου στο παράθυρο διαλόγου SYSDATA Directory μπορεί να προκαλέσει αυτό το ζήτημα.
- Τα προβλήματα συνδεσιμότητας δικτύου είναι ένας κοινός ένοχος για αυτό το πρόβλημα.
- Η εσφαλμένη απενεργοποίηση του προγράμματος χειρισμού σφαλμάτων θα προκαλέσει μερικές φορές προβλήματα.
Πώς μπορώ να διορθώσω το σφάλμα χρόνου εκτέλεσης 5;
Πριν από οτιδήποτε άλλο, εφαρμόστε τους ακόλουθους ελέγχους:
- Χρησιμοποιήστε το DateDiff όταν εργάζεστε με βρόχους.
- Αποτρέψτε τον χρήστη από το να δει το φύλλο κατά τη διάρκεια ενός χρόνου με τη ρύθμιση
Εφαρμογή. ScreenUpdating = Λάθος
παρά τη χρήσηExportAsFixedFormat
1. Αλλάξτε τις ρυθμίσεις σε Break on Unhandled errors
- Εκκινήστε το Excel στον υπολογιστή σας και κάντε κλικ στο Προγραμματιστής αυτί.
- Στη συνέχεια, κάντε κλικ στο Visual Basic. Εναλλακτικά, μπορείτε να πατήσετε Alt + F11.
- Κάνε κλικ στο Εργαλεία καρτέλα και κάντε κλικ στο Επιλογές.
- Τώρα, επιλέξτε το Γενικός καρτέλα και κάτω Σφάλμα παγίδευσης, επιλέξτε Διάλειμμα στα μη χειριζόμενα σφάλματα.
Εάν το πρόβλημα είναι η εσφαλμένη ρύθμιση του προγράμματος χειρισμού σφαλμάτων, αυτό θα πρέπει να αντιμετωπίσει το σφάλμα χρόνου εκτέλεσης και να το διορθώσει μόνιμα.
2. Ελέγξτε τον κωδικό σας για επιπλέον κενά
- Ανοίξτε τον κωδικό σας.
- Εντοπίστε τη γραμμή στην οποία καλείτε το φύλλο προορισμού.
- Εάν ένα φύλλο προορισμού έχει κενό στο όνομά του, περιβάλετέ το με μονά εισαγωγικά, όπως αυτό:
TableDestination:="'" & myDestinationWorksheet. Ονομα & "'!" & myDestinationRange
Οι χρήστες το έχουν επίσης επιβεβαιώσει ως βιώσιμη λύση για αυτό το σφάλμα.
- Κωδικός σφάλματος διακοπής 0x0000008E: Πώς να το διορθώσετε
- Τι είναι το Msoia.exe και πώς μπορεί να διορθωθεί τα λάθη του;
- Το Ole32.dll δεν βρέθηκε: Πώς να το διορθώσετε ή να το κατεβάσετε ξανά
Επιπλέον, εάν αντιμετωπίσετε ένα παρόμοιο πρόβλημα, όπως το Σφάλμα χρόνου εκτέλεσης 3709, μη διστάσετε να διαβάσετε τον οδηγό μας για να το αντιμετωπίσετε αμέσως.
Ομοίως, ο οδηγός μας για τη διόρθωση Σφάλμα Python Runtime μπορεί επίσης να είναι χρήσιμο εάν αντιμετωπίσετε ένα τέτοιο πρόβλημα.
Εάν έχετε περαιτέρω ερωτήσεις ή προτάσεις, αφήστε τις στην ενότητα σχολίων.
Εξακολουθείτε να αντιμετωπίζετε προβλήματα;
ΕΥΓΕΝΙΚΗ ΧΟΡΗΓΙΑ
Εάν οι παραπάνω προτάσεις δεν έχουν λύσει το πρόβλημά σας, ο υπολογιστής σας ενδέχεται να αντιμετωπίσει πιο σοβαρά προβλήματα με τα Windows. Προτείνουμε να επιλέξετε μια λύση all-in-one όπως Fortect για την αποτελεσματική επίλυση προβλημάτων. Μετά την εγκατάσταση, απλώς κάντε κλικ στο Προβολή & Διόρθωση κουμπί και μετά πατήστε Ξεκινήστε την επισκευή.